Tools for Springfield's Construction Environment
Springfield sits at 1,270 feet elevation on the Ozarks plateau, with terrain that ranges from 700 to 1,300 feet. This creates unique challenges:
Winter Weather
Winters average 35°F with occasional ice and freezing rain (December–February). Our laser levels operate in sub-freezing conditions with optional battery heaters for extended use.
Sloped Terrain
The Ozarks' rolling landscape requires laser equipment with extended range and excellent accuracy on angles up to 30°+. Rotary lasers are essential for residential foundation work and utility trenching.
Limestone Soil & Rock
Springfield's karst topography features limestone ledges and springs. Grade lasers help contractors navigate bedrock and identify proper drainage—critical for building permits and long-term site stability.
Tree Cover & Visibility
Wooded lots are common in residential areas. Our laser receivers with extended-range optics cut through shadows and morning mist on the Springfield plateau.
